Abstract
A titanium sheet including the following chemical components in mass %: Cu: 0.70 to 1.50%, Cr: 0 to 0.40%, Mn: 0 to 0.50%, Si: 0.10 to 0.30%, O: 0 to 0.10%, Fe: 0 to 0.06%, N: 0 to 0.03%, C: 0 to 0.08%, H: 0 to 0.013%, elements except the above and Ti: 0 to 0.1% each, with a total amount of the elements being 0.3% or less, and the balance: Ti, wherein A value defined by Formula (1) is 1.15 to 2.5 mass %, and the titanium sheet having a metal microstructure in which an area fraction of an α phase is 95% or more, an area fraction of a β phase is 5% or less, and an area fraction of an intermetallic compound is 1% or less, wherein an average crystal grain size D (μm) of the α phase is 20 to 70 μm and satisfies Formula (2).
